Stone wall of castle ruins at Galley Head in Ireland painted in the photo app Psykopaint.I then ran it though Stackables, another photo app, in order to add more character. Now it looks like an old canvas that has been rolled up for a century or two. (I went a little crazy Psykopainting Irish landscapes in this post.)
Sketch Guru is one of my favourite apps, the only problem being that all the images are never larger than the size of the iPad you’re saving them in. I would love it if they allowed an option to save something that would be a little larger than 4 x 6″ when printed. This is their ‘gouache’ look.
This misty look from Pixlromatic just says Ireland to me.
Snapseed has a similarly misty look plus the ‘frames’ are much higher quality than Pixlromatic’s. Snapseed has a great set of text opions as well.
